decoy
/di'kɒi/ uk 词频 #10810
decoy 是什么意思
- 中文释义
- n. 圈套, 诱骗
- vt. 诱骗
- 英文释义
- n. a beguiler who leads someone into danger (usually as part of a plot)
- v. lure or entrap with or as if with a decoy
